Reasons For Malignant High Blood Pressure

Malignant hypertension generally happens in individuals with pre-existing hypertension. Nevertheless, it can likewise create unexpectedly in people with previously normal blood pressure levels. The exact root causes of deadly high blood pressure are not totally recognized, but a number of aspects might add to its growth.

An uncontrolled boost in high blood pressure may arise from different hidden conditions, such as:

  • Kidney disease: Particular kidney problems, such as renal artery stenosis or glomerulonephritis, can cause the advancement of malignant hypertension.
  • Adrenal gland issues: Adrenal lumps or conditions, like pheochromocytoma or Cushing’s syndrome, can create elevated high blood pressure levels.
  • Substance abuse: Making use of illicit compounds like cocaine or amphetamines can activate an unexpected and severe rise in blood pressure, leading to malignant hypertension.
  • Drug non-compliance: Failing to take recommended high blood pressure medications as guided can add to unrestrained hypertension and the development of malignant high blood pressure.
  • Other variables: Particular medical problems, such as pregnancy-related hypertension (preeclampsia) or autoimmune diseases like systemic lupus erythematosus, can increase the threat of deadly high blood pressure.

Therapy of Malignant Hypertension

Deadly hypertension is a medical emergency that requires timely therapy. The primary goal of treatment is to decrease blood pressure degrees swiftly and support the condition to avoid organ damage.

Treatment options for deadly hypertension may include:

  • Intravenous medicines: Drugs carried out via a capillary can swiftly minimize blood pressure degrees in hypertensive emergencies. Instances include nitroglycerin, labetalol, or sodium nitroprusside.
  • A hospital stay: Many instances of malignant high blood pressure require health center admission for close monitoring and extensive care. This enables health care specialists to make certain high blood pressure degrees are properly taken care of and to resolve any type of issues that might occur.
  • Dental medicines: As soon as blood pressure is stabilized, dental drugs may be recommended to control blood pressure in the long term. These might include diuretics, calcium network blockers, angiotensin-converting enzyme (ACE) preventions, or beta-blockers.
  • Treatment of underlying conditions: If deadly high blood pressure is caused by an underlying clinical problem, such as kidney disease or adrenal gland issues, resolving and handling these problems are crucial for long-lasting high blood pressure control.
